A magical dream catcher is a beautiful and mystical object that has been a part of Native American culture for centuries. It is believed to have the power to catch bad dreams and allow only good dreams to pass through it. The dream catcher is usually made of a hoop, traditionally made out of willow, and is often crafted in a circular shape. It is then adorned with a web-like pattern using various materials such as string, thread, or yarn. Attached to the bottom of the dream catcher are feathers and beads, which are meant to represent good dreams and happy thoughts. The purpose of the dream catcher is to hang it above a person's sleeping area so that it can catch any negative dreams or thoughts that may come their way during the night.

According to Native American beliefs, bad dreams get caught in the web of the dream catcher and are then dissolved by the morning light, while good dreams are allowed to pass through and gently slide down the feathers to the sleeping person. In addition to its practical purpose of catching bad dreams, the dream catcher also holds deep spiritual significance.

It is believed to protect the person from negative energies and serve as a symbol of unity between humankind and the natural world. The circular shape of the dream catcher is thought to represent the circle of life and the interconnectedness of all living things. Today, dream catchers have become popular decorative items, not only for their cultural and spiritual significance but also for their aesthetic appeal. They can be found in various sizes, colors, and designs, often incorporating different symbols and patterns. Many people who do not follow Native American traditions still hang dream catchers in their homes, viewing them as beautiful and meaningful decorations.
